**Onboarding — Mistral-free naming note: Quillhaven Functions**

Security review context: our serverless handlers on the Quillhaven platform suffer cold starts of up to three seconds, so a keep-alive pinger runs every five minutes. The pinger reads its configuration from `handlers/.env`, including `PING_INTERVAL=300` and the target stage name. Immediately after those entries, the file contains the token the pinger presents to the invocation gateway.

sealed setting: VAULT_KEY20=c8ea1e419912889df6b4

Ticket #FAC — Reception, Marlow Point. The guest Wi-Fi desk beside the main reception counter has been reconfigured. Reception staff should now issue visitors a printed voucher rather than reading credentials aloud. Vouchers are stored in the locked drawer under the desk. To open the drawer and restock, staff should use the code below.

door code, yagap-bahof: bdg-O-05

**Runbook: Flaky integration tests — Ledgerpipe payments**

If the settlement suite fails intermittently, check the sandbox clock skew first; the mock acquirer in Ledgerpipe rejects authorizations older than 30 seconds, and CI runners sometimes drift. Retry once before escalating. Most flakes trace back to timeout values that were tuned for local runs. The CI environment runs with the following configuration.

config for tawif-bagef:
[sorwyn]
team = sorys
access_code = ac_9ba40c
host = sorwyn.ordingrid.local
port = 5000
owner = aldok.quenion
peer = belath.paliqcloud.local

## Nightbarrow Scheduler — Environments

The Nightbarrow scheduler runs nightly data backfills across three environments: dev, staging, and prod. Each environment has its own queue, cron offset, and concurrency ceiling to avoid contention with the Larkspur ETL jobs. Staging mirrors prod's schedule but targets a snapshot dataset, so failures there are safe to retry freely. Never copy prod credentials into lower environments; each environment resolves its own secrets at boot. The per-environment configuration values are shown below.

deployment values, bajof-fahop:
zorael:
  log_level: info
  metrics_host: metrics.zorael.qorvellabs.internal
  pool_size: 8